If you refer to the units, power (any power, not just electrical power) is energy divided by time. The SI unit is the watt, equal to 1 joule/second.
As a general rule of electrical engineering amps multiplied by volts equals watts.
The supplementary units are the radian and steradian units. This SI classification was made in 1995 but was later abandoned and the units were regrouped as derived units.

No, the unit of electric current is the ampere (A). The volt (V) is the unit of electric potential difference or voltage.
